Dr. Toru Yano is Ken Yano's father and a famous scientist in his hometown. He is one of the main protagonists of the 1971 Toho film, Godzilla vs. Hedorah.

History

Showa era

Godzilla vs. Hedorah

An avid marine biologist, Toru Yano and his son, Ken Yano were carrying out a dive when they both encountered an unusual tadpole-like creature which began to produce large amounts of sulfuric acid. He and his son both suffer scars from this, with Yano suffering a large scar on the left side of his face. After having their injuries treated, Ken named the creature Hedorah, and Toru began to investigate a specimen he managed to retrieve during the expedition. Later, his independent investigations into Hedorah's chemistry led to the discovery of its weakness, and he suggested the construction of two massive electrodes to be used against the pollution kaiju.
